On October 19th the House of Lords held a short debate on a motion moved by Lord Lexden. It provided an opportunity for peers to consider how the Northern Ireland economy, now heavily dependent on the public sector, could be rebalanced in order to stimulate private sector growth.
The main issue highlighted in the debate was whether a special low rate of corporation tax of 12.5 per cent should be introduced to boost investment and jobs.
